Oscar Piastri found his form while his championship rivals made mistakes in Sprint Qualifying. Recap Friday in Qatar with GPblog's F1 Today here! Piastri claims Sprint pole in Qatar
The Australian driver
topped Sprint Qualifying of the 2025 Qatar Grand Prix. George Russell will start alongside him on the front row, while
Lando Norris completed the top three.
After the session, Piastri admitted that he thought his lap was over by Turn 4.
He told Sky Sports:
"It almost went horribly wrong at Turn 4! Turning left in a right-hand corner is never a good thing. I lost two tenths."Norris and
Max Verstappen made mistakes in SQ3 as well. The Briton went wide in the last corner on his final lap, while the Dutchman did the same in Turn 4 on his first attempt. They will start the Sprint from third and sixth place on the grid.

Norris and Verstappen doubt making progress in the Sprint
Both Norris and Verstappen doubt they will have the chance to overtake during the Sprint.
The McLaren driver said: "I would be stupid not to try and win but it is impossible to overtake so I think I will probably finish P3."
Verstappen added:
"With this balance [on the RB21], it will not be a lot of fun. It will be more about trying to survive I guess and make some changes going into qualifying." Hamilton's Ferrari woes continue
